Triamcinolone + pirfenidone is a combination of two pharmaceutical agents. Triamcinolone is a synthetic corticosteroid with potent anti-inflammatory and immunosuppressive properties, used to treat various inflammatory and autoimmune conditions such as allergic states, dermatologic diseases, endocrine disorders, gastrointestinal diseases, hematologic disorders, neoplastic diseases, nervous system disorders (including multiple sclerosis), ophthalmic diseases, renal and respiratory diseases[3][5]. Pirfenidone is an antifibrotic small molecule approved for the treatment of idiopathic pulmonary fibrosis (IPF). It exerts its effects by reducing fibroblast proliferation and inhibiting the production of fibrogenic mediators such as transforming growth factor beta; it also has anti-inflammatory and antioxidant properties[1][2][6][8]. The combination may be considered in clinical or research settings where both anti-inflammatory and antifibrotic actions are desired.
